Application:
Nitobenzyl ester based nonionic PAGs (NIPAG 2) NIPAG 2 was prepared from 2-fluoro-6-nitrobenzyl bromide with silver sulfonate.

| Solubilidad | Insoluble in water. |
|---|---|
| Punto de fusión (°C) | 50-54℃ |
| Peso molecular | 234.020 g/mol |
| XLogP3 | 2.400 |
